Introduce Different Writing Techniques

When making handwriting jewelry, there are many different writing techniques that can be utilized to create unique and attractive pieces. One way to start is by using a calligraphy pen with permanent ink to write a favorite quote or saying. This technique requires quite a bit of precision and patience. Another method is to dip an old-fashioned quill into waterproof ink and write directly onto the surface of the pendant. Drawing with a stylus or quill also gives handwriting jewelry a unique look and feel.

A third option is to use a thin brush and paint lettering directly onto the jewelry; this is great for anyone who likes experimentation. Finally, some craft stores carry hammer-stamping kits which allow customers to stamp custom words into metal blanks – creating nice, bold letters with just a few taps of the hammer hand! No matter what option readers choose, they’ll end up with beautiful handmade pieces.

Share Tips & Tricks

One tip for making handwriting jewelry is to let the ink dry completely before securing the paper to the frame. This can prevent accidental smudging and help maintain a smooth, neat appearance for your piece. It’s also helpful to practice writing on regular paper before trying out your design on the material you plan to use for the jewelry – this will give you an idea of what kind of lines or curves you need in order to make your design look good. You may also want to practice writing with a variety of different pen sizes and styles until you find a style that works well for each piece. Finally, remember that when cutting out shapes for your jewelry, slight imperfections may actually add character to the design – so don’t be too hard on yourself if a shape isn’t perfect!

Suggest Suitable Occasions for Wearing Handwriting Jewelry

Handwriting jewelry makes thoughtful and meaningful gifts for any occasion. It is an ideal way to commemorate a special event or honor a loved one in a unique way. It can also be worn as an accessory or as a reminder of a cherished memory.

Weddings: Handwriting jewelry is the perfect way to display personalized messages from the bride and groom on their wedding day. Cufflinks, pendants and other pieces featuring the couple’s names or initials make for keepsakes that will last beyond their special day.

Anniversaries: Jewelry featuring the handwritten note of your loved one’s dedication is the perfect gift for anniversaries. Necklaces and bracelets inscribed with personal messages are always appreciated by couples celebrating years together.

Memorials: Handwriting jewelry can be used to create meaningful memorial items celebrating a passed relative or friend. Charms, rings and earrings featuring their words remind us even after they are gone that they are still with us in spirit.

Graduations: To congratulate someone for achieving success with their degree, create a piece of jewelry with personalized words of encouragement to give as a graduation present. From pendants engraved with wise words to necklaces adorned with meaningful symbols, this type of jewelry is sure to show how proud you are of them on their big day!
